The George Washington University Hospital (GW Hospital) continues to be a leader in providing the highest level of quality and compassionate healthcare for the D.C. Region. U.S. News & World Report released the 2023-2024 ratings and rankings, recognizing GW Hospital as a Best Regional Hospital. GW Hospital ranks 5th in the region, which includes hospitals in D.C. and parts of Maryland, Virginia and West Virginia. GW Hospital achieved "High Performing" status in two specialty areas, Neurology and Neuroscience. GW Hospital also received "High Performing" designations for the following 10 procedures: COPD, Diabetes, Heart Attack, Heart Failure, Kidney Failure, Leukemia, Lymphoma and Myeloma, Lung Cancer Surgery, Pneumonia, Prostate Cancer Surgery and Stroke. GW Hospital was awarded the American College of Cardiology’s National Cardiovascular Data Registry (NCDR) Chest Pain – Myocardial Infarction (MI) Registry Platinum Performance Achievement Award for 2023, and is the only hospital in Washington, D.C. to be recognized for this service line.* "At GW Hospital, we are proud to offer a range of advanced services and treatments. Our multidisciplinary care teams are dedicated to outstanding clinical services, research, and education to improve care, quality, and outcomes for our patients," says Ulises Torres, MD, Chief Quality Officer at GW Hospital. These recognitions by U.S. News & World Report place us within the top hospitals in the region, highlighting the expertise, commitment and diligence delivered to each patient in our care.” Children’s National Hospital, GW Hospital’s NICU partner, was ranked the number two hospital in the country for neonatology by U.S. News & World Report. GW Hospital also provides high-quality care in the region through its designation as a Level I Trauma Center and Comprehensive Stroke Center. Position Summary
Fulfills the needs of patients, families, and community by providing Occupational Therapy services in accordance with licensure, certification, training, and regulatory requirements. Seeks an Occupational Therapist with a passion for treating lymphedema and oncology populations; will treat patients with general lymphedema conditions as well as lymphedema due to cancer. Evaluates selected diagnoses accurately using basic techniques in acute care and rehabilitation. Requests clarification of orders from physicians and consults with other OTs as needed. Considers the physical, psychosocial, developmental, and cultural needs of patients. Develops and implements treatment plans using problem-solving and clinical reasoning. Documents evaluations, progress notes, and discharge notes in a clear and concise manner, consistent with department policies and KOTA/AOTA. Supervises Level 1 students independently and Level 2 students after one clinical experience, with assistance from the Student Coordinator as needed. Meets all District of Columbia requirements for continuing education. Maintains current CPR certification. Follows all departmental procedures. Demonstrates good rapport with patients and professionalism with other professionals, patients, and visitors. One of the nation’s largest and most respected providers of hospital and healthcare services, Universal Health Services, Inc. (NYSE: UHS) has built an impressive record of achievement and performance, growing since its inception into a Fortune 500 corporation. Headquartered in King of Prussia, PA, UHS has 99,000 employees. Through its subsidiaries, UHS operates 28 acute care hospitals, 331 behavioral health facilities, 60 outpatient and other facilities in 39 U.S. States, Washington, D.C., Puerto Rico and the United Kingdom.
